Latvia - Export of Machining Centres, Unit Construction Machines and Multi-Station Transfer Machines, for Working Metal
Since 2014, Latvia Export of Machining Centres, Unit Construction Machines and Multi-Station Transfer Machines, for Working Metal jumped by 36.2% year on year. With €6,410,082 in 2019, the country was number 15 comparing other countries in Export of Machining Centres, Unit Construction Machines and Multi-Station Transfer Machines, for Working Metal. Latvia is overtaken by Croatia, which was number 14 at €6,447,471 and is followed by Slovakia at €5,030,865. Germany lead the ranking with €2,610,617,754.16 in 2019, that is +3.6% compared to 2018. Italy, Belgium and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ireland recorded the best 5 years average growth at +157.6% per year, while Cyprus rec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
